Question 169: To ask the Tánaiste and Minister for Finance if, in view of his reply to Parliamentary Question No. 58 of 5 July 2007, the Office of Public Works has been in contact with Westmeath County Council in relation to a serious flooding problem occurring on the land of a person (details supplied) in County Westmeath which is rendering a significant area of the said land sterile and it is not possible to farm same; if steps will be taken either by his Department or in conjunction with Westmeath County Council to remedy same; and if he will make a statement on the matter. As stated in the previous response to the House in this matter, the flooding problems are due to the construction of a road bridge and as such are the responsibility of Westmeath County Council. Westmeath County Council has not contacted the OPW to request assistance to alleviate the flooding problems. The OPW is, however, available to provide advice and technical support if requested. The Deputy may wish to contact the Council directly in the matter.
